At 19:30 on July 24, 2023, the Chinese men's basketball team ushered in a warm-up match with the Venezuelan men's basketball team. This is the second time the two teams have met since the 2019 World Cup group stage. Although the Chinese team has not defeated Venezuela in the past five confrontations, the lineups of both sides have undergone significant changes, adding a lot of highlights to this game. In particular, the Venezuelan team mainly dispatched young players this time, and did not send many famous players like in previous years, and their overall strength has declined. Venezuela was once regarded as a mid-to-upstream team in South American basketball. Therefore, this game is both a challenge and a test for the Chinese team.

On the eve of the game, some not very optimistic news came from the Chinese men's basketball team. The team announced that Yang Hansen will miss the upcoming Asian Men's Basketball Team, and player Zhou Qi also went to the United States for treatment on the 21st due to injury during training. Despite this, the Chinese men's basketball team tonight is still full of vitality, including 12 players including Zhao Rui, Hu Jinqiu, Gao Shiyan, Hu Mingxuan, Cheng Shuipeng, Zhu Junlong, Zhao Jiayi, Zhang Ning, Liao Sanning, Li Xiangbo, Yu Jiahao and Wang Junjie.

At the beginning of the game, both sides seemed a little nervous, with a low shooting percentage and a high defensive intensity. The Chinese team got a lot of open shots from the outside, but never hit. Four minutes after the game started, the Chinese team made only 1 of 8 shots, but Venezuela led 4-2. Until the game lasted 5 minutes and 33 seconds, Wang Junjie's three-pointer helped the Chinese team overtake the score and lead 5-4. However, Venezuela quickly counterattacked, hitting a 5-0 climax, rewriting the score to 9-5 again. Then, Cheng Shuipeng also responded with a three-pointer, Lopez then made a beautiful throw, and Yu Jiahao created a 2-1 under the basket, successfully tied the score. As the game approached the end of the quarter, Cheng Shuipeng and Zhang Ning joined forces to complete a 7-2 climax, and the Chinese men's basketball team led 18-13 at the end of the first quarter.

The second quarter, the game continued fiercely. Grae scored a layup through a breakthrough, while Zhao Rui scored two consecutive three-pointers from the outside, helping the Chinese team gradually widen the gap. Venezuela relies on Ghada and Fulda's personal abilities to catch up, but Hu Jinqiu's strong performance at the basket and his continuous score helped the Chinese team stabilize the lead. Wang Junjie's goal at the basket gave the Chinese team a 10-point lead at one point. In the subsequent game, Liao Sanning also scored a wonderful 2 1, but failed to hit and add penalty. Tovar stopped Venezuela's decline through free throws. Despite this, the Chinese team did not relax and launched a 5-1 offensive, expanding its lead to 15 points. At the end of the half, the score was frozen at 37-22. In the third quarter, as the game deepened, the Chinese team's offensive became more and more fierce. At the beginning, it hit a 7-2 climax, quickly widening the gap to 20 points. Although Venezuela tried to curb the Chinese team's offense through Gra's breakthrough, the Chinese team showed a multi-point offensive method, and with a 14-2 attack wave, the gap was widened to 30 points. At this time, the score has changed to 58-28. However, as the game entered the end of the third quarter, the Chinese team's offense fell into some stagnation, and Venezuela took the opportunity to respond to a 12-5 offense, narrowing the gap slightly. After three quarters, the Chinese men's basketball team still led 63-40.

entered the last quarter, and although the shooting percentage of both sides declined, the Chinese team expanded the lead to 25 points with Zhao Jiayi's free throw and Hu Jinqiu's throw. At 3 minutes and 47 seconds, Pugliati made a jump shot and broke the scoring drought for several minutes. In the subsequent game, Yu Jiahao and Wang Junjie used tip-offs and three-pointers from the outside to expand the Chinese team's lead again. The gap quickly approached 30 points, and the suspense of the game completely disappeared. In the end, the Chinese men's basketball team defeated Venezuela 77-49.

In terms of player performance, Hu Jinqiu is undoubtedly the most stable inside scoring point for the Chinese team. His performance on the court is impeccable. He not only grabbed positive rebounds, but also performed efficiently on the offensive end, doing a great job in both mid-range shooting and ending at the basket. In the end, he contributed 14 points and 6 rebounds, continuing to consolidate his position as the CBA Finals MVP. Cheng Shuipeng turned the situation for the Chinese team through two timely three-pointers when the team was lagging behind in the first quarter, and finally gained 14 points and 3 assists. The defensive end was also worthy of recognition. As the captain, Zhao Rui demonstrated his all-round ability. He not only eased his ability when organizing offense, but also contributed to defense and shooting, and eventually scored 11 points, 3 rebounds and 3 assists.

Yu Jiahao handed over an all-around data of 13 points and 8 rebounds, while Wang Junjie contributed 8 points and 4 rebounds. Several other players such as Zhao Jiayi, Zhang Ning, Liao Sanning and Hu Mingxuan also performed properly and completed the game tasks. Although their performance fluctuated slightly, they had a qualified level overall. On the contrary, Zhu Junlong, Li Xiangbo and Gao Shiyan's performance was slightly disappointing and needed to be adjusted in the next game.
